Ignatiev: The Moldovan side is trying to imitate activity and distract from pressing issues

PMR Foreign Minister expects that OSCE Special Representative will make efforts to negotiate within the established agenda

Tiraspol, January 23. /Novosti Pridnestrovya/. PMR Foreign Minister Vitaly Ignatiev expressed concern over the negotiation process degradation at a meeting with Special Representative of the OSCE Chairman-in-Office Thomas Mayr-Harting.

“We drew attention to the application of unilateral restrictions and means of pressure in relation to Pridnestrovie. There are problems related to the banking sector, the freedom of movement of vehicles, and now even to our citizens` kidnapping,” Vitaly Ignatiev told reporters.

Regarding attempts to include new and initially unresolved issues in the Chisinau negotiation agenda, such as harmonization of the tax laws of Moldova and Pridnestrovie, Vitaly Ignatiev noted:

“The Moldovan side can offer any ideas and initiatives. But first of all, it is necessary to fulfill the previously reached agreements. I repeat that neither in the field of telecommunications, nor in banking, nor in the closure of criminal cases are we observing any dynamics. On the contrary, there is a regression. The Moldovan side is trying to imitate activity, but actually distracts from pressing issues, from fulfilling its obligations, switching attention to some new topics. Together, we will try to prevent a complete break in the 5 + 2 format.”

Vitaly Ignatiev emphasized that Pridnestrovie was ready to work constructively and to move forward.

“For our part, we have fulfilled all obligations. A lot of promises is made by Chisinau, yet there is no result,” the PMR Foreign Minister emphasized.

According to him, Pridnestrovie hopes that the Albanian chairmanship in the OSCE and the Special Representative of the Chairman-in-Office will make efforts to ensure that the negotiation process is conducted within the framework of the established agenda.

The Organization of Security and Collaboration in Europe, along with Russia and Ukraine, is a mediator in the negotiations on the Moldovan-Pridnestrovian settlement. From January 1, 2020, the chairmanship of the OSCE passed to Albania.
